Upper Mustang Trekking

Journey into the mystical Upper Mustang, one of Nepal's most extraordinary trekking destinations, where ancient Tibetan culture, dramatic desert landscapes, and centuries-old monasteries create an unforgettable Himalayan adventure. Once an independent kingdom and closed to foreign visitors until 1992, the Upper Mustang Trek offers a rare opportunity to explore a region where traditions, architecture, and lifestyles have remained remarkably unchanged for centuries.

Located in the rain shadow of the Annapurna and Dhaulagiri ranges, Upper Mustang is often called the "Last Forbidden Kingdom of Nepal." Unlike the lush green valleys found elsewhere in Nepal, this remote region features colorful sandstone cliffs, deep canyons, wind-eroded rock formations, hidden caves, and vast high-altitude deserts that resemble the landscapes of the Tibetan Plateau.

The adventure begins with a scenic flight or drive to Jomsom, the gateway to Mustang. Following the ancient Himalayan salt trade route, you'll trek through picturesque villages such as Kagbeni, Chele, Syangboche, Ghami, Tsarang (Charang), and finally reach the legendary walled city of Lo Manthang (3,840 m), the historic capital of the former Kingdom of Mustang.

Lo Manthang is the cultural heart of Upper Mustang, where you'll explore narrow alleyways, traditional mud-brick houses, royal palaces, and centuries-old monasteries adorned with exquisite murals, ancient scriptures, and Tibetan Buddhist art. Visits to famous monasteries such as Jampa Monastery, Thubchen Monastery, and Chode Monastery provide fascinating insights into the region's spiritual heritage.

One of the unique experiences of the trek is exploring the mysterious sky caves carved high into the cliffs. Some of these caves are over 2,000 years old and have served as meditation retreats, burial chambers, and ancient settlements, adding an element of mystery and history to the journey.

Throughout the trek, you'll enjoy spectacular views of Nilgiri, Dhaulagiri (8,167 m), Annapurna I (8,091 m), Tilicho Peak, Tukuche Peak, and numerous snow-capped Himalayan giants. The combination of dramatic desert landscapes and towering mountains creates one of the most unique trekking environments in Nepal.

Upper Mustang is also home to the vibrant Tiji Festival, an annual Tibetan Buddhist celebration held in Lo Manthang. Featuring colorful masked dances, traditional rituals, and centuries-old ceremonies, the festival attracts visitors from around the world and offers a unique cultural experience.

As Upper Mustang is a restricted area, a special trekking permit is required, helping preserve the region's fragile culture and environment while limiting visitor numbers.

Suitable for trekkers with moderate fitness, the Upper Mustang Trek follows well-established trails at relatively moderate elevations compared to many Himalayan treks, making it an excellent choice for travelers seeking culture, history, and unique landscapes.
